The remedy is named as “oil pulling remedy” basically this is an ayurvaidic remedy and is also known as “kavala” ,capturing hype in many western countries these days.  The remedy involves swishing one tablespoon of an organic oil in your mouth on an empty stomach for about 20 minutes just like a regular mouth wash. After this spit out the oil and do a toothbrush with your regular toothpaste. Its better to use coconut oil for the best results but if you are allergic to coconut oil you can use any organic oil. This method has a simple mechanism of working when you swish oil in your mouth the bacteria producing cavities and bad breath gets dissolved into the oil and goes away on spitting.

2. Get enough sleep.  

A good sleep plays a very vital role in maintenance of your health and recharging your body for a full working day. Getting quality sleep can help your body in maintaining mental and physical health. An 8 hour sleep is as important as our diet and exercise, without it we can not even function properly and might even become ill. Insufficient sleep can increase obesity in adults and children. 

3. Eat vegetables and Fruits. 

A diet which is rich in veges and fruits can lower your blood pressure, lower the risk of a heart disease and even decrease your digestive problems. Where fast food and junk calories can lead to a weight gain, fruits and veges maintain your weight at an optimum level and also protect your body from several diseases as its a gift of nature. 

4. Drink enough water.

Water is known to be the most natural hydrating liquid It promotes Cardiovascular health, keeps our joints and muscles working and helps to extract the toxins out of our body, it also maintains your blood sugar level and makes your skin glow more and revive you from temperature.
